    I have found the solution. As there were no instructions on setting up theme twenty seventeen. I played around until it worked. Here are my findings.

    Create pages with a featured image. Build and save your menu. Go to customize, theme options and update the Front Page Section Content w/new menu items. Save & Publish, refresh homepage and done.
